Is WordPress too complex for an IT service owner who has never built a website?

WordPress offers extensive customization but requires significant time for security updates, plugin management, and hosting configuration. For owners prioritizing service delivery over web development, simpler, hosted solutions often provide a more efficient path to a professional presence.

How do I get my IT firm to show up in Google Maps for local searches?

Focus on maintaining a verified, updated Google Business Profile with current service areas and hours. Consistent NAP (Name, Address, Phone) data across all directories and a high volume of positive, verified reviews are significant factors in local map ranking.
